Specifications
Package / Case: Radial, Box
DC Cold Resistance: 0.097 Ohms
Size / Dimension: 0.335" L x 0.157" W x 0.315" H (8.50mm x 4.00mm x 8.00mm)
Color: --
Operating Temperature: -40°C ~ 85°C
Approvals: cUL, UL
Melting I²t: 0.068
Breaking Capacity @ Rated Voltage: 100A
Mounting Type: Through Hole
Series: TE5® 395
Response Time: Fast
Voltage Rating - AC: 125V
Current Rating: 800mA
Fuse Type: Board Mount (Cartridge Style Excluded)
Moisture Sensitivity Level (MSL): --
Part Status: Active
Lead Free Status / RoHS Status: --
Packaging: Tape & Box (TB)
